indypwr, I am one of those guys singing the praises of the spoiler depot spoiler, been on the 'ol SC for over 2 years now with no signs or wear, fading, cracking, or anything adverse. It's all in all a great spoiler for under $175. I have the "lighted '97 style spoiler" because I knew I'd eventually want to update my 92 to the 97+ body style. The spoiler was my very first mod and I couldn't be happier with the results. If buying from the dealer makes you feel better they'll sell you the exact same spoiler for an extra $300+ and put a little "Toyota" or "Lexus" sign on it where no one can see it. I'm joking of course, but it's a great spoiler all in all...I had spoiler depot paint mine and paid a body shop less than $70 to put it on.
